価格分析
Average prices remain above conventional plasticizers because of renewable feedstock costs, lower production scale, and compliance-driven formulation requirements. Price increases have moderated as capacity expands, but premium grades for food-contact and medical applications still command higher pricing.

Typical gross margins range from 18 to 28 percent, with higher margins available for specialty grades, certified renewable products, and application-specific formulations. Commodity-like grades face pressure when feedstock costs rise or when competition intensifies.
製造・生産分析
A medium-scale bio plasticizer plant typically requires USD 12–35 million depending on feedstock route, purification complexity, and product grade mix. Higher investment is needed for food-contact and specialty grades due to quality systems and testing.

Manufacturing Process Flow
- Feedstock preparation and inspection
- Catalytic reaction or esterification
- 分離・洗浄・精製
- Blending, filtration, and final quality testing
- Storage, packaging, and dispatch
バリューチェーン分析
- Renewable feedstock sourcing from oils, acids, and bio-based intermediates
- Chemical conversion through esterification, epoxidation, or related processing routes
- Purification, blending, and performance adjustment for target applications
- Distribution through specialty chemical channels and direct sales teams
- Formulation support for compounders, converters, and brand owners
- End-use integration into flexible polymers, coatings, packaging, and consumer products

市場ダイナミクス
Drivers
- Rising demand for non-phthalate and low-VOC materials in consumer and industrial products
- Stronger regulatory support for safer chemical additives in North America and Europe
- Growing brand commitments to renewable and recyclable material content
- Expanding use in packaging, toys, flooring, and flexible PVC applications
Restraints
- Higher input costs compared with conventional plasticizers
- Performance trade-offs in some high-heat or demanding applications
- Limited large-scale production capacity in certain bio-based feedstock routes
- Price-sensitive buyers in cost-focused end markets
Opportunities
- Expansion into medical, food-contact, and premium packaging applications
- New capacity additions using renewable feedstocks and improved process efficiency
- Product development for high-performance flexible polymers
- Long-term supply agreements with consumer brands and compounders
Challenges
- Maintaining stable supply of bio-based raw materials
- Meeting performance consistency across diverse applications
- Competing against lower-cost conventional plasticizers
- Navigating differing regional regulatory standards and certification demands
